Am I right, that Octane VR is no other software than Octane Render?
Or am I missing something here?
For the Competition I use my regular 'Octane Render Software' + license and I redner with a 'panoramic cam' in 'cube map setting ' + stereo set to 'side by side'. right?

Yes, that's correct in a nutshell, although OctaneVR has a few more limitations than the normal version. Here you can find more information how to set up your pano stuff:
